Разработчик веб-приложений с четким пониманием современных технологий и подходов к разработке. Специализируюсь на создании и автоматизации сервисов с использованием Django, REST API, ORM и баз данных PostgreSQL и Redis. Стремлюсь писать чистый, эффективный и безопасный код, уделяя внимание качеству и производительности. Постоянно совершенствую свои навыки, осваиваю новые технологии и инструменты для улучшения процессов разработки.
Обладаю опытом работы с такими технологиями, как Python (включая ООП), Django, REST framework, PostgreSQL, Redis, SQLite, Celery, CI/CD, Docker, Unit Testing (Pytest), Git, Nginx, а также базовыми знаниями HTML5, CSS3 и C/C++. Умею эффективно работать в команде, быстро нахожу общий язык с коллегами и стремлюсь к достижению общих целей.
Готов к решению сложных задач, постоянному обучению и внедрению новых технологий в проекты.
Ключевые навыки:
- Разработка веб-приложений на Python (Django, REST API, ORM)
- Работа с базами данных (PostgreSQL, Redis, SQLite)
- Автоматизация процессов (Celery, CI/CD)
- Контейнеризация и развертывание (Docker, Nginx)
- Написание тестов (Unit Testing, Pytest)
- Версионный контроль (Git)
- Знание основ веб-технологий (HTML5, CSS3)
- Базовые знания C/C++
Опыт работы:
Преподаватель Python и C++ (2022 – 2024)
- провел более 700 групповых занятий
- более 90% моих учеников успешно сдают промежуточные и итоговые тестирования
- легко нахожу общий язык с учениками
- создаю и поддерживаю комфортную атмосферу на занятиях
Проекты:
- Web-приложение для ведения блога
Функционал: позволяет пользователям создавать, редактировать и удалять публикации, просматривать ленту новостей с помощью RSS. Также предусмотрена функция поиска по ключевым словам в заголовке и в тексте поста. (Django, PostgreSQL)
- Онлайн-сервис и API
Реализовал функционал, который позволяет пользователям: публиковать рецепты; просматривать уже опубликованные; добавлять любимые рецепты в избранное; формировать список покупок из ингредиентов и сохранять его; удалять и редактировать опубликованные рецепты. (Django, Django REST framework, postgreSQL)
- Backend социальной сети для обмена фотографиями
Разработал Backend приложения. (Django, Django REST framework, postgreSQL)
- API для социальной сети
Реализовал регистрацию, авторизацию, восстановление пароля, подписки на пользователей, добавление комментариев. (Django, DjangoORM, Django REST Framework, SQLite)
- Web-приложение, интегрированное в Telegram
Функционал: регистрация, добавление товаров в корзину, оформления заказа через Telegram. (Aiogram, Django, postgreSQL, gunicorn, nginx)
- Бот со встроенной оплатой внутри Telegram (Aiogram, gunicorn, SQLite)